The Amazing Spider-Man on Nintendo DS condenses web-swinging open-world action into bite-sized, mission-based levels. Players patrol pixelated Manhattan, wall-crawling, combatting street thugs, and tackling boss encounters across a mix of side-scrolling and top-down segments. The DS controls emphasize timing and pattern recognition — web-line grapples, punch combos, and gadget use — making for a challenging handheld adaptation that rewards patience. Nostalgic low-poly visuals and chiptune-tinged scores capture handheld era charm while quick missions and collectibles keep play sessions compact. Fans of portable action-platformers will find a familiar, brisk Spider-Man experience tuned for pick-up-and-play sessions.
